Przykłady nimbostratus

  • Nimbostratus usually has a thickness of about 2000 m.

  • Nimbostratus and some cumulus in this family usually only achieve comparatively moderate vertical extent.

  • Nimbostratus can have multiple associations as low, middle, or multi-tage depending on the criteria used by various authorities.

  • Of the latter, "upward-growing" cumulus mediocris produces only isolated light showers, while "downward growing" nimbostratus is capable of heavier, more extensive precipitation.

  • The occurrence of cumulonimbus and nimbostratus together is uncommon, and usually only nimbostratus is found at a warm front.

  • Downward-growing nimbostratus can be as thick as most upward-growing vertical cumulus, but its horizontal extent tends to be even greater.

  • Lightning from an embedded cumulonimbus cloud may interact with the nimbostratus but only in the immediate area around it.

  • The cloud layer achieves significant vertical extent as it lowers and changes into nimbostratus.
